Steam Error Cannot Play Modern Warfare 3 Multiplayer | iw5mp.exe has stopped working

While researching the problem I also found a similar Modern Warfare 3 error that is happening to people, “iw5mp.exe has stopped working.” There were various suggestions and fixes people suggested. Below are the ones that fixed my nephews problem and allowed him to play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3 once more.
Please try Solution 1 first. If that does not work then proceed to solution 2.
Solution 1
1.1 - Open up Steam (Do not open up Modern Warfare 3. If it is open please fully close/exit the game).
1.2 - With Steam open RIGHT-click the Steam icon on your taskbar which is usually located on the bottom-right of your screen.
1.3 - Select “Library”
1.4 - RIGHT-click, “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3” and select “Properties”
1.5 - Click the “LOCAL FILES” tab
1.6 - Click the “VERIFY INTEGRITY OF GAME CACHE” button
1.7 - Please be very patient. This process may take up to 20 minutes.
1.8 - Once that is complete within the exact Library section you were just in go through the process again but for “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3 - Multiplayer” (Do the “VERIFY INTEGRITY OF GAME CACHE” thing for this too).
1.9 – When you have verified the integrity for both “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3” and “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3 – Multiplayer”, RESTART your PC
Play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3 Multiplayer. Does it work? If yes then have fun :-)
If it still does not work try Solution 2.
Solution 2
2.1 – Open up Modern Warfare 3
2.2 – Select the Multiplayer menu (do not hit play)
2.3 – Go to OPTIONS then select “Voice”
2.3 – Select “Yes” for “Mute All”
2.4 – Exit the game and restart your PC
2.5 – Open up Modern Warfare 3 multiplayer (but do not play it yet)
2.6 – Go into the Options>Voice again and make sure that “Yes” is still selected for “Mute All”
2.7 – If everything is okay then play Modern Warfare 3 Multiplayer
